The regional estimates of the GPS satellite and receiver differential code biases
The Differential Code Biases (DCB), which are also termed hardware delay biases, are the frequency-dependent time delays of the satellite and receiver. Possible sources of these delays are antennas and cables, as well as different filters used in receivers and satellites. These instrumental delays affect both code and carrier measurements.
